Understanding the Types of Driving Licenses
Before diving into the application procedure, it is important to comprehend the numerous types of driving licenses available in Poland. Here's a short overview:
License CategoryDescriptionCategory AMPermits driving mopeds and light quadricycles.Category A1For driving light bikes (up to 125cc).Category AAllows driving motorbikes without displacement constraints.Category BThe most common, permitting people to drive cars with an optimum weight of 3.5 tons.Category CFor heavy trucks over 3.5 tons.Category DFor buses and lorries created to carry more than 8 travelers.
Each category has unique requirements and advantages, dealing with the diverse driving requirements of residents.
Step-by-Step Process for Obtaining a Driving License in Wyszków
Obtaining a driving license can appear intimidating initially. Nevertheless, by following a structured approach, prospective drivers can simplify the procedure. Here are the steps included:
Eligibility Verification:
Applicants must be at least 18 years of ages for a Category B license. More youthful prospects may qualify for Categories AM, A1, or A depending upon their age.
Medical checkup:
A medical exam carried out by an authorized doctor is required to ensure candidates are fit to drive.
Theoretical Training:
Enroll in a driving school in Wyszków to go through theoretical training. Topics include traffic regulations, road indications, and safe driving techniques.
Theoretical Exam:
Successfully pass the theoretical exam, which evaluates knowledge of traffic rules and policies.
Practical Training:
Complete practical driving lessons covering important skills such as maneuvers, parking, and navigation in various conditions.
Driving Test:
Schedule and finish the driving test, which includes showing driving efficiency under the guidance of an inspector.
Application for License:

The overall expense of acquiring a driving license in Wyszków varies based on numerous elements, such as the driving school chosen and the kind of license made an application for. Here's an approximate breakdown of expenditures:
Expense ComponentApproximated Cost (PLN)Driving school costs (theory + practice)2,000 - 4,000Medical examination150 - 300Theory exam cost30 - 50Practical driving test charge150 - 200License issuance cost100 - 200Overall Estimated Cost: PLN 2,430 - 4,700
Note that these are approximate expenses, and real expenditures might differ based upon personal situations and options.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Can I make an application for a driving license if I have not completed driving lessons?
No, completing both theoretical and practical driving lessons is necessary before you can obtain a driving license.
2. For how long does it take to obtain a driving license in Wyszków?
The duration varies depending upon specific progress, but on average, finishing the process can take anywhere from 2 to 6 months.
3. What should I do if I stop working the driving test?
If you stop working the driving test, you can retake it after a waiting duration. It is suggested to take extra lessons before your next attempt.
4. Are there any age exemptions for younger drivers?
Yes, individuals aged 16 or 17 might get a license for categories AM or A1 with adult approval.
5. Can I drive outside Poland with a Polish driving license?
Yes, a Polish driving license is usually acknowledged throughout the European Union, permitting you to drive in other EU nations.
